模块结构图初涉

模块结构图是用于描述系统模块结构的图形工具,不仅描述了系统的子系统结构与分层的模块结构,还清楚地表示了每个模块的功能 模块结构图初涉模块结构图初涉

模块:模块是可以组合,分解和更换的单元,是组成系统,易于处理的基本单位

调用:在模块结构图中,用连接两个模块的箭头表示调用。箭头总是由调用模块指向被调用模块,但是应该理解成被调用模块执行后又返回到调用模块
模块结构图初涉

数据:当一个模块调用另一个模块时,调用模块可以把数据传送到被调用模块处处理,而该调用模块又可以将处理的结果送回调用模块。在模块之间传送的数据,用与调用箭头平行的带空心的箭头表示,并在旁边标上数据名。
模块结构图初涉

控制信息:为了指导下一步的执行,模块间有时还必须传送某些控制信息。例如,数据输入完成后给出的结束标志,文件读到末尾产生的文件结束标志等。控制信息与数据的主要区别是前者只反映数据的某种状态,不必进行处理。在模块结构图中,用带实心圆的箭头表示控制信息

转接符号:当模块结构图在一张图上画不下,需要转接到另外一张纸上,或者为了避免图上线条交叉时,都可以使用转接符号。
模块结构图初涉

例:
模块结构图初涉

模块结构图初涉